NACW is governed by a Board of Directors composed of an Executive Committee
which includes the President, Vice President, Treasurer and Secretary, and fourteen
Directors elected across the United States with only one Director from a state.
The National Office is located within the Montgomery County Commission for Women
in Rockville, Maryland.
NACW is the national advocate for government commissions for women which holds
a unique and positive position for women's equity and justice and touches millions
of women, playing a significant role in national policy and legislative development.
NACW, the advocate for all women, is the bridge between government and the
private sector. Our membership reflects all age, economic, ethnic and social
groups.
